What is the correct spelling for DAZZED?

If you're looking for the correct spelling instead of "dazzed", the accurate term is "dazed". This term refers to a state of confusion, bewilderment or disorientation. So, next time you encounter the misspelling "dazzed", remember to use "dazed" instead for precision and clarity in your writing.
